The art of the Arabian

Here’s a little something for the horse lover and shutterbug in your life – a sumptuous, and we do mean sumptuous, coffee-table book that plumbs the majesty and mystique of the Arabian horse.

“Arabian Horses: The World of Ajmal Arabian Stud” (100 images, 144 pages) tells the tale of these elegant creatures, the pride of the Arabian people and an object of fascination worldwide, as seen through the collection of 25 Arabians at the Ajmal Arabian Stud farm in Kuwait. The book, which features photographs by Wojciech Kwiatkowski and an introduction by Judith E. Forbis, is a hand-bound limited edition contained in a linen clamshell case. It’s a perfect volume for the spring gift season (Mother’s Day, Father’s Day, graduations) that captures the spirit, grace and dynamism of these magnificent animals.
